Understanding Sonso Yuca – What Makes It Special

What Exactly Is Sonso Yuca?

Sonso Yuca is a traditional Caribbean side dish that showcases the simplicity and elegance of Caribbean cuisine. Made from yuca (cassava root), this dish involves boiling tender cassava until it reaches the perfect texture, then mashing it with butter, garlic, and sometimes a hint of broth to create a creamy, comforting puree.

The term “sonso” refers to the soft, mashed consistency of the dish—it’s neither too thick nor too thin, but perfectly balanced. Unlike chunky mashed potatoes, authentic Sonso Yuca should be smooth and velvety, almost like a luxurious side dish that melts on your tongue.

This dish is deeply rooted in Dominican, Puerto Rican, and other Caribbean cuisines. It’s traditionally served alongside grilled meats, stews, and seafood dishes at family dinners and celebrations. The beauty of Sonso Yuca lies in its versatility—it works with almost any main course and carries the subtle flavors of the islands in every spoonful.

What to Look For When Ordering

When you’re ordering Sonso Yuca at a restaurant, quality indicators matter. The dish should arrive warm, with a consistent creamy texture. It shouldn’t be watery or lumpy. The color should be pale yellow or slightly golden, and you should notice the aroma of butter and garlic immediately.

Ask the restaurant staff how they prepare it. The best Sonso Yuca uses fresh yuca, real butter, and simple seasonings—no shortcuts or excessive cream. If they describe their process confidently, that’s usually a good sign they take authenticity seriously.

The temperature matters too. Sonso Yuca is best enjoyed hot, right off the heat. If it arrives lukewarm or cold, politely ask for a fresh serving. A good restaurant will accommodate without hesitation.

DIY Sonso Yuca Recipe for Home Cooks

You don’t need to visit a restaurant to enjoy amazing Sonso Yuca. With fresh yuca and a few simple ingredients, you can create restaurant-quality results in your own kitchen. This beginner-friendly recipe takes about 30 minutes from start to finish.

Ingredients You’ll Need:

  • 2 lbs fresh yuca (cassava root), peeled and cut into chunks
  • 4 tablespoons real butter (not margarine)
  • 4 cloves fresh garlic, minced
  • 1 cup chicken or vegetable broth (or reserved cooking water)
  • Salt and white pepper to taste
  • Optional: a pinch of nutmeg for subtle warmth

Step-by-Step Instructions:

First, prepare your yuca properly. Peel away the thick brown outer skin using a vegetable peeler or sharp knife. Remove the thin fibrous layer beneath. Cut the white flesh into 2-inch chunks and remove any pink or woody center (this is inedible). Rinse thoroughly under cold water.

Boil a large pot of salted water and add your yuca chunks. Cook for 15-20 minutes until very tender. You should be able to pierce them easily with a fork. Drain completely in a colander, reserving one cup of the cooking liquid.

While the yuca cooks, heat your butter in a separate pan and sauté the minced garlic over medium-low heat until fragrant and light golden (about 2 minutes). Don’t let it brown—this keeps the flavor clean and buttery.

Place the cooked, drained yuca in a large bowl. Add the garlic butter and begin mashing with a potato masher. Gradually add the broth one quarter-cup at a time, stirring and mashing continuously. You’re aiming for a smooth, creamy consistency—not too thick, not too thin. Season with salt and white pepper to taste.

Pro Tips for Restaurant-Quality Results

The secret to authentic Sonso Yuca near me quality at home lies in technique. Use a food mill or ricer if you have one—it creates the smoothest texture better than a masher. Never use a blender, which can make the yuca gluey.

Temperature control matters. Keep your Sonso Yuca on low heat while adding broth, stirring gently to incorporate air and prevent the mixture from becoming dense. The finished dish should have a light, fluffy consistency despite being a puree.

Taste as you go. Every yuca root and broth brand behaves slightly differently, so adjusting seasoning and consistency is crucial. Sonso Yuca should taste primarily of butter and garlic, with yuca’s natural earthiness as the base—not salty or overwhelming.

FAQs

Where Can I Find Fresh Yuca to Make Sonso Yuca at Home?

Fresh yuca is increasingly available in mainstream grocery stores, though specialty shopping is often necessary. Hispanic markets and Caribbean food stores almost always stock fresh yuca, usually in the produce section. You’ll recognize it as long brown roots, similar in appearance to small yams but with thick, bark-like skin.

If your local area doesn’t have specialty markets, check larger grocery chains with robust produce sections or ethnic food departments. Whole Foods and similar premium grocers carry yuca. You can also order fresh yuca online from specialty produce retailers for delivery.

When selecting yuca, look for firm roots without soft spots or mold. Avoid ones that feel lightweight or have visible damage. Fresh yuca keeps refrigerated for up to two weeks, though it’s best used within a few days. Some stores also sell frozen peeled yuca, which is convenient if you can’t find fresh, though fresh always produces superior flavor and texture in Sonso Yuca.

Is Sonso Yuca Gluten-Free and Suitable for Dietary Restrictions?

Yes, authentic Sonso Yuca is naturally gluten-free. Yuca (cassava) is a root vegetable containing no gluten whatsoever. The basic preparation using butter, garlic, and broth is also gluten-free, making it an excellent side dish for people with celiac disease or gluten sensitivity.

However, always verify at restaurants. Some establishments add flour to thicken Sonso Yuca or prepare it in shared equipment with gluten-containing foods. Ask specifically about preparation methods and cross-contamination risks. Most Caribbean restaurants can confirm gluten-free status immediately since this is a straightforward dish.

For vegans and vegetarians, traditional Sonso Yuca uses butter, which is not vegan. However, it’s easy to adapt using plant-based butter or high-quality olive oil instead. The garlic and seasoning remain the same, and the dish tastes remarkably similar. Many modern restaurants can accommodate this substitution upon request.

Why Is My Homemade Sonso Yuca Too Thick or Too Watery?

Consistency issues are the most common challenge when making Sonso Yuca at home. If your mixture is too thick, you didn’t add enough broth. The solution is simple: warm additional broth and gradually incorporate it while stirring. Warm broth mixes more smoothly than cold liquid and won’t cool the dish.

If your Sonso Yuca is too watery, you likely added too much broth or your yuca wasn’t cooked long enough. Overcooking sometimes releases excess moisture. Next time, reduce broth quantity and cook yuca until just tender (not falling apart). If it’s already too watery, you can rescue it by stirring in a tablespoon of butter or creating a slurry of yuca flour and broth to thicken.

The ideal consistency is like mashed potatoes but slightly creamier. It should hold its shape on a plate but remain spreadable. Every yuca root and broth brand differs slightly, so precise measurements matter less than understanding how to adjust. Start conservatively with broth and add more as needed.

Can I Prepare Sonso Yuca in Advance and Reheat It?

Absolutely, though fresh is always superior. Sonso Yuca keeps refrigerated for three to four days in an airtight container. To reheat, place it in a saucepan over low heat, stirring frequently and adding small amounts of warmed broth to restore the original creamy consistency. The dish tends to thicken as it cools, so reheating with added liquid is essential.

Alternatively, reheat in the microwave in 30-second intervals, stirring between each interval and adding broth as needed. Microwave reheating sometimes unevenly heats Sonso Yuca, so stovetop methods usually produce better results. You can also freeze Sonso Yuca for up to one month, though texture may become slightly grainier. Thaw overnight in the refrigerator before reheating.

For meal prep, prepare the yuca through the cooking and draining stage, then store separately from the garlic butter. This allows you to combine and finish fresh components just before serving, maximizing flavor and texture.
